I watched on the news the other day don't sign into any accounts that require a password if you are in a public place that has free wifi like Mcdonalds, Starbucks, libraries, airports because it's easy for people to get your passwords from the places that have free wifi. After seeing that I will only sign into banking accounts and other accounts with passwords only from home or a connection where you have to put in a password.
